425: ENDRA Life Sciences Merges with Noble Africa, Eyes Helium Project

ENDRA Life Sciences announced a definitive merger agreement with Noble Africa, aiming to gain exposure to Renergen's Virginia Gas Project and renaming the combined entity Noble Africa Inc.

Summary

  • ENDRA Life Sciences reported its second quarter 2026 financial results and provided a business update.
  • The company entered into a definitive merger agreement with ASP Isotopes Inc., Noble Africa LLC, and Renergen Limited on June 25, 2026.
  • Upon completion, ENDRA will be renamed Noble Africa Inc., with the transaction providing exposure to Renergen's Virginia Gas Project.
  • A private placement is expected to generate approximately $50 million in gross proceeds, closing concurrently with the merger.
  • ENDRA completed a $3.8 million private placement on May 28, 2026, to strengthen its balance sheet.
  • Operating expenses were managed, with research and development down 39% and sales and marketing down 92% compared to Q2 2025.
  • Cash used in operations in Q2 2026 was $0.9 million, down from $1.1 million in Q2 2025.
  • The company reported a net income of $160,000 for Q2 2026, a significant improvement from a net loss of $1.2 million in Q2 2025, largely due to gains from its digital asset treasury.

Negatives

  • Total operating expenses increased to $1.5 million in Q2 2026 from $1.3 million in Q2 2025.
  • Non-cash stock-based compensation increased significantly to $542,000 in Q2 2026 from $89,000 in Q2 2025.
  • The company's core technology (TAEUS) for steatotic liver disease detection is still in development, with no practical diagnostic tools currently available.
  • Significant reliance on the success of the proposed merger and associated financing.
  • The company has a history of losses and limited cash resources, with a substantial accumulated deficit.
